Study Summary

A randomized clinical trial evaluating the reduction of HIV risk behaviors and drug use when providing integrated behavioral drug and HIV risk reduction counseling (BDRC) along with methadone maintenance treatment in Wuhan, China

Interventions

  • BEHAVIORAL Behavioral Drug and HIV Risk Reduction Counseling (BDRC)
  • BEHAVIORAL Drug counseling
